WebTo do querying on elements inside arrays, $elemMatch is used : SampleModel.find ( { dates : { $elemMatch: { date : { $gte: 'DATE_VALUE' } } } } ) If you're using a single query condition, you can directly filter: SampleModel.find ( { 'dates.date': { $gte: 'DATE_VALUE' } } ) Share Improve this answer Follow edited Dec 4, 2024 at 6:34 WebApr 11, 2024 · Let’s imagine that you have a single collection “Tasks,” but the actual tasks belong to different customers. WebMay 25, 2014 · 1 Answer Sorted by: 8 The month parameter in the JavaScript Date constructor is 0-based, so you're querying for docs having an updatedAt value after June 24, 2014. > new Date (2014, 5, 24) Tue Jun 24 2014 00:00:00 GMT-0500 (Central Daylight Time) So your query is fine otherwise and you just need to update it to use 4 for the month: WebApr 30, 2024 · mongoose, how to query the maximum or minimum value in the a object-array and return the object. 0. ... You start of much the same. WebFeb 8, 2024 · To expand a bit on the answer, the dates are stored as full date-time value. Think of it as ISODate("2024-02-07T00:00:00.000Z") is storing February 7th 2024 at midnight. Comparing ISODate("2024-02-07T00:00:00.000Z") and ISODate("2024-02-07T01:00:00.000Z") will not show them as equal since the full “datetime” is being …
